Abstract:
Novel methods for determining the 1s Lamb shift of hydrogenic ions are outlined. In one method the energy of a 2–1 transition
in the hydrogenic ion of nuclear charge Z is compared to a 4–2 transition in the hydrogenic ion of charge 2Z. A second method exploits close coincidences between Lyman series transitions in ions of similar Z.
